AHA honored for ‘Protect the Heroes’ campaign

The American Society of Association Executives today awarded a to the AHA, The Creative Coalition and the Association for Healthcare Philanthropy for their integrated “Protect the Heroes” campaign.
“” allows individuals to choose and contribute to a hospital’s emergency relief fund to help fight COVID-19, raising more than $300,000 to date.
ASAE said the award recognizes and celebrates extraordinary contributions associations make to society by enriching lives, creating a competitive workforce, preparing society for the future, driving innovation and making a better world.
